首頁 > 資料庫 > Oracle > 主體

oracle中Regr_SLOPE的用法

下次还敢
發布: 2024-05-02 23:00:28
原創
1004 人瀏覽過

Oracle 中的 REGR_SLOPE 函數用於計算線性迴歸斜率。其語法為 REGR_SLOPE(y, x),其中 y 是因變量,x 是自變數。可用於計算一組資料的斜率,根據條件篩選斜率或對不同組的資料進行平均。

oracle中Regr_SLOPE的用法

Regr_SLOPE 函數在Oracle 中的用法

Regr_SLOPE 是Oracle 中的一個函數,用於計算一組資料的線性迴歸斜率。

語法

<code>REGR_SLOPE(y, x)</code>
登入後複製

其中:

  • #y:因變數的陣列或欄位
  • x:自變數的陣列或欄位

用法

  1. 計算線性迴歸斜率

    <code>SELECT REGR_SLOPE(sales, population) FROM cities;</code>
    登入後複製

    此查詢將傳回城市銷售和人口資料點的線性迴歸斜率。

  2. 使用聚合函數

    <code>SELECT AVG(REGR_SLOPE(sales, population)) FROM cities GROUP BY region;</code>
    登入後複製

    此查詢將根據城市所屬地區對線性迴歸斜率進行平均。

  3. 條件篩選

    <code>SELECT REGR_SLOPE(sales, population)
    FROM cities
    WHERE population > 1,000,000;</code>
    登入後複製

    此查詢將傳回人口超過 1,000,000 的城市的線性迴歸斜率。

注意事項

  • yx 陣列或列必須具有相同長度。
  • 輸入資料必須是數值類型。
  • 如果自變數 (x) 中存在重複值,則 Regr_SLOPE 函數傳回 NaN。
  • NaN 值或空值會從計算中排除。

以上是oracle中Regr_SLOPE的用法的詳細內容。更多資訊請關注PHP中文網其他相關文章!

相關標籤:
來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板
關於我們 免責聲明 Sitemap
PHP中文網:公益線上PHP培訓,幫助PHP學習者快速成長!